EU adopts largest ever sanctions package against Russia

European Union member states have adopted the most extensive sanctions package against Russia to date. Under the new sanctions, 52 ships from Russia’s ‘shadow fleet’ and dozens of Russian officials were blacklisted. US Court Cancels Sanctions on Crypto Mixer Linked to N. Korea Hack

A federal appeals court has ruled that the US Treasury Department exceeded its authority by sanctioning cryptocurrency mixer Tornado Cash after a North Korean hacking group used the software to launder more than $455 million. Russia Sells Shares in Angolan Diamond Mines due to sanctions

A government official in Angola announced that Russian stakes in the country’s two major diamond mines have been sold to an Oman-backed fund as a result of international sanctions.
